Earlier, we reported that the leader of the Uzbek diaspora in the Russian city of Perm urged his compatriots to war in Ukraine to help the official Moscow.

The Embassy of the Republic of Uzbekistan in the Russian Federation reacted to this situation and warned compatriots not to form volunteer battalions and/or to participate in hostilities on the territory of foreign States, referring to the criminalization of these acts.

“The diplomatic office informs that according to Article 154 of the Criminal Code of the Republic of Uzbekistan “On recruitment”, illegal participation in armed conflicts or military actions in the territory of a foreign state is a crime.  The penalty for such acts is imprisonment for up to 10 years.

The Embassy warns citizens of the Republic of Uzbekistan that all persons, without exception, whose participation in the commission of unlawful actions provided for in the above-mentioned article of the Criminal Code of the Republic of Uzbekistan was objectively reported will be brought to criminal responsibility”, - the report said.

The Embassy also called on Uzbek citizens, not to distract propaganda and be careful.
